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2006.11.05;
Скачать: CL | DM;

Вниз

Quantum Grid, обычная таблица   Найти похожие ветки 

 
Juice ©   (2006-10-18 14:34) [0]

Может кто знает - нужно использовать сабж как обычную (т.е. не БД) таблицу, для этого есть там представление cxTableView (а не cxDBTableView как в случае с БД). Как управлять содержимым этой таблицы, добавлять/удалять записи, ячейки ?


 
Курдль ©   (2006-10-18 14:49) [1]

Есть в том же наборе такая весчь типа dxMemData.
Это аналог датасэта (ближайший аналог Клиент ДатаСэта). Его можо подкорячить к гриду, а данными управлять программно.


 
Jeer ©   (2006-10-18 14:52) [2]

Juice ©   (18.10.06 14:34)

Имеет смысл использовать обычную.. - далее по тексту.


 
Juice ©   (2006-10-18 14:55) [3]

У меня его нет :(


 
jack128 ©   (2006-10-18 14:58) [4]

а у тебя нету цели использовать утюг как обычный компьютер?


 
Курдль ©   (2006-10-18 15:04) [5]


> Juice ©   (18.10.06 14:55) [3]
> У меня его нет :(

А TClientDataset у тебя есть? Его используй. Только придется за собой Midas.dll таскать (если я ничего не путаю).


 
Sandman29 ©   (2006-10-18 15:05) [6]

Курдль ©   (18.10.06 15:04) [5]

Начиная с D6, можно midas.dll включать в exe (uses MidasLib в любом модуле)


 
Juice ©   (2006-10-18 15:12) [7]


> jack128 ©   (18.10.06 14:58) [4]
> а у тебя нету цели использовать утюг как обычный компьютер?
>

Компонента предназначена как для БД  таблиц так и для обычных.


 
Курдль ©   (2006-10-18 15:14) [8]

Кстати, мы ушли от сути. Я вспомнил, что Делфи - это не VS и там еще есть разделение контролов на "DB" и "не-DB". Так для последних есть четкие методы типа AddColumn, AddRow и т.д.
В части, касаемой компонентов от Developer Express, имеется гипер-исчерпывающая информацией с огромным количеством примеров и демо-программ.


 
Jeer ©   (2006-10-18 15:18) [9]

Курдль ©   (18.10.06 15:14) [8]

Для первых, есть такие же методы (Columns), основанные на выборке полей через наследников от DataSet, например TQuery.


 
Juice ©   (2006-10-18 15:52) [10]

Может кому пригодится, делается это через датаконтроллер:
https://www.devexpress.com/Support/Center/ViewIssue.aspx?issueid=DB4616&searchtext=tcxgridtableview&pgid=48409584-e723-41af-b1d3-52dd97577823&pid=8b369e9e-f81b-4a73-822e-37c84ccafcf7


 
Курдль ©   (2006-10-18 15:58) [11]


> Juice ©   (18.10.06 15:52) [10]
> Может кому пригодится, делается это через датаконтроллер:


Фашисты писали! :)

private
   { Private-Deklarationen }
 public
   { Public-Deklarationen }
 end;

Да, хороший способ.
Но я уже так далек от этих проблем, после перехода на VS (появились новые) :)


 
Palladin ©   (2006-10-18 15:59) [12]

Если таблица без датасета, то к level создается обычный table а не DB Table


 
Stanislav ©   (2006-10-18 17:38) [13]

Добавление записи:
I:=cxGrid1TableView1.DataController.AppendRecord;
cxGrid1TableView1.DataController.SetValue(I,1,"File");
Дальше я думаю разберешься.
Все это можно сохранять в файл, поток.



Страницы: 1 вся ветка

Текущий архив: 2006.11.05;
Скачать: CL | DM;

Наверх




Память: 0.49 MB
Время: 0.042 c
15-1160590597
стьюдентЪ
2006-10-11 22:16
2006.11.05
Что вы делаете для души ?


2-1161292434
fog
2006-10-20 01:13
2006.11.05
Глюк !!!


6-1149245388
Dush
2006-06-02 14:49
2006.11.05
IP адрес выданный провайдером


2-1161201316
Meganop
2006-10-18 23:55
2006.11.05
Вопрос про массив.


4-1150349210
r@bbit
2006-06-15 09:26
2006.11.05
Как отличить виртуальный привод от реального?